37-0119 - Prohibition Against Certain Uses of Trichloroethylene.

(a) "Extraction solvent" means a solvent used to separate a specific
substance from a mixture.
(b) "Refrigerant" means a chemical that is used as a heat carrier in a
cooling mechanism and that changes from liquid to gas and back again in
the refrigeration cycle.
(c) "Trichloroethylene" means a chemical with the Chemical Registry
Abstract Services Number of 79-01-6.
(d) "Vapor degreaser" means a substance boiled to a vapor that
condenses onto metal parts, causing beading and dripping, and that
removes contaminants from the parts.
